ARP Header Bolts Wet Torque Spec
I recently installed headers and I definitely have a leak where they bolt to the heads. I used ARP Header bolts except for one OEM bolt on each side because the ARP wouldn't start to thread in properly in those holes. I applied ARP antisieze to all bolts and I've read on here that 17 ft lbs seems to be the torque spec everyone uses but I only torqued to 12.5 ish ft lbs to account for the antisieze and I'm scared to go much tighter. For those of you running ss bolts and antisieze what did you torque them to?

I didn’t use ARP, but did use the stage 8 locking bolts that came with my headers. Torqued them to 20 ft/lbs, and not a problem since install. (They are stainless and I used anti seize)
